#d69e84 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d69e84 is composed of 83.9% red, 62%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 26.2% magenta, 38.3%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 19 degrees, a saturation of 50% and a lightness of 67.8%. #d69e84 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#ad3d09.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

#d69e84 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d69e84 has RGB values of R:214, G:158, B:132 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.26, Y:0.38,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 14065284.

Shades and Tints of #d69e84
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090503 is the darkest color, while #fdfbfa is the lightest one.
